State legislators visit Middle Georgia Regional Airport

On Tuesday, September 26, a few state legislators stopped by the Middle Georgia Regional Airport to get a tour and update on what is happening at the airport. Mayor Lester Miller and Aviation Director Doug Faour greeted the group before making their way into the airport terminal. 

The tour was one of nine stops the Georgia Airport Association (GAA) set up various legislators across the state. House Appropriations Chairs Matt Hatchett and Clay Pirkle, Director at Senate Budget and Evaluation Office Brent Churchwell, GAA Vice-President Amber Clark, and Senator Frank Ginn stopped by Macon for about an hour. 

“The future of the airport is looking bright,” said Mayor Lester Miller. “We are doing a lot of things to help this airport grow and thrive for many years to come.” 

Faour talked about the plans for the expansion of Runway 5 and how adding the extra 500 feet will make a vast difference to the airport that already makes $160 million a year in economic output. 

“The Middle Georgia Regional Airport will be better suited to compete for business, and we will be successful,” said Faour. “We’ll be successful because of our proximity to the world’s busiest airport, our proximity to Robins Air Force Base, and our location in the center of the state.” 

Georgia legislators were passengers on two general aviation flights visiting 9 of our 103 Georgia airports. Legislators were able to visit and inspect airport needs and review recent investments made to our Georgia Airport System.   

“The GAA organized the flights and appreciates the time given by our State leaders to understand the need and value of our statewide aviation system.  The visit included stops in ten communities to tour the facilities and visit with local airport management, stakeholders, and local community leaders; all of which benefit from the investment Georgia has made to protect and expand its airports,” said the GAA.
